Mr Michael Howard 202 Clause 175, page 111, line 18, at end insert'(1A) The provisions of Schedule 36 have effect in relation to adult placement carers with the modifications specified in subsections (1B) to (1G) below. (1B) References to the "provision of foster care" are to the provision of services under a placement agreement as an adult placement carer. (1C) The expressions "placement agreement" and "adult placement carer" have the meanings given to them by regulation 45 of the Care Homes Regulations 2001 (S.I. 2001/3965) ("Regulation 45"), and paragraph 4 does not apply. (1D) References to a "foster care arrangement" are to arrangements by which an individual provides services under a placement agreement as an adult placement carer otherwise than as part of a trade, profession or vocation carried on by that individual. (1E) References to "foster care receipts" and "total foster care receipts" are to receipts in respect of the provision of services under a placement agreement as an adult placement carer. (1F) References to a child are to a service user within the meaning of Regulation 45. (1G) The weekly amount for a service user for the purposes of ascertaining the individual's limit is £270, and paragraph 8(2) does not apply.'.

NEW CLAUSESTax credits for individual savings accounts and personal equity plans
Mr Michael Howard [R] NC1 To move the following Clause:'.Section 76(1)(a) of the Finance Act 1998 (c. 36) shall cease to have effect.'.
Top rate of income tax
Adam Price NC2 To move the following Clause:'A top rate of income tax (on earnings over £50,000) shall be charged for the year 2003-04, and for that year the top rate shall be charged at 50%.'.

Transfers between settlements
Mr Michael Howard NC4 To move the following Clause:'. Section 90 of the Taxation of Chargeable Gains Act 1992 (transfers between settlements) is amended with effect from 9th April 2003, by deleting sub-paragraph 90(5).'.
ORDER OF THE HOUSE [6th MAY 2003]That the following provisions shall apply to the Finance Bill:
Committal 1.(1) Clauses 1, 4, 5, 9, 14, 22, 42, 56, 57, 124, 130 to 135, 138, 139, 148 and 184 and Schedules 5, 6, 19, 21, 22 and 25, and any new Clauses and Schedules tabled by Friday 9th May 2003 relating to excise duty on spirits or R&D tax credits for oil exploration, shall be committed to a Committee of the whole House.(2) The remainder of the Bill shall be committed to a Standing Committee. 2. Proceedings in Committee of the whole House shall be completed in two days. 3.(1) Proceedings in the Standing Committee shall (so far as not previously concluded) be brought to a conclusion on 12th June 2003. (2) The Standing Committee shall have leave to sit twice on the first day on which it meets. 4. When the provisions of the Bill considered, respectively, by the Committee of the whole House and by the Standing Committee have been reported to the House, the Bill shall be proceeded with as if it had been reported as a whole to the House from the Standing Committee.
Other proceedings 5. Any other proceedings on the Bill may be programmed.
ORDER OF THE HOUSE [8th MAY 2003]That the programme order of 6th May 2003 shall be amended by the substitution in paragraph 1(1) (provisions committed to Committee of the whole House) of the words 'Schedules Nos. 5, 6, 19 and 25' for the words 'Schedules Nos. 5, 6, 19, 21, 22 and 25'.
